我想要删除绘制的多段线的一部分,因为它是遍历的,有点像GPS。我目前正在通过:onLocationChanged从LocationListener界面获取位置更新。
我从google-directions请求中绘制折线。它现在的行为就像一个GPS,如果你偏离了道路,它会发出另一个请求来绘制正确的多段线:
if (!PolyUtil.isLocationOnPath(mLatLng,polylines.get(index).polyline.getPoints(), true, 20)) {
//remove it
//add a new polyline
}
通过在每次位置更改
为什么当我想要使用谷歌地图V3.0 (JavaScript应用编程接口)绘制一条具有许多点(超过大约7个点)的折线时,多段线不会出现,尽管当我试图绘制具有几个点的多段线时,多段线却出现了?
编辑:
代码
var polyOptions = {strokeColor: '#FF0000',strokeOpacity: 0.6,strokeWeight: 5}
var poly = new google.maps.Polyline(polyOptions);
var path = poly.getPath();
var bounds2 = new google.maps.LatLn
我有这个功能,在点击一个标记后,在与项目相关的点之间画一条线。
function showDetails(itemId)
{
var newlatlng = itemId.position;
var xmlhttp;
if (window.XMLHttpRequest)
{// code for IE7+, Firefox, Chrome, Opera, Safari
xmlhttp=new XMLHttpRequest();
}
else
{// code for IE6, IE5
xmlhttp
以下是我必须在我的程序中为在google地图上绘制折线而编写的代码
假设response.SelectedTruck.length=150
response.SelectedTruck中包含的值是纬度和经度
我必须在m变量中推送所有纬度和经度值
//code for draw polyline
for (var i = 0; i < response.SelectedTruck.length; i++) {
var m = response.SelectedTruck[i];
我需要创建多条折线,每条折线都有自己的颜色,并且它们的标记相互连接,我使用的是谷歌地图v3。
例如,我有五个标记,它们都通过红色多段线相互连接。现在我想以多种配色方案显示这条红色多段线,第一条多段线为绿色,第二条为蓝色,第三条为黑色,依此类推。
以下是我的代码
<script type='text/javascript'>
var poly;
var map;
var path;
var i = parseInt(0, 10);
var marker;
function initialize() {
var chicago = new go
我们遵循了关于在IIS 上设置flask run的指导,它运行得很好,但是当我们从VS代码中执行flask run时,我们会得到以下内容
PS J:\Apps\prod> flask run
* Serving Flask app 'wsgi.py' (lazy loading)
* Environment: production
WARNING: This is a development server. Do not use it in a production deployment.
Use a production WSGI server inst
我有一组编码的折线,从方向服务的结果中检索,并且我已经将它们存储在一个php数组中。
使用下面的代码,我可以添加一条多段线。如何将其修改为同时添加多条多段线?
var code = '_mjsB{qp{LvAe@xImCjGgBf@St@Qf@Un@e@Hm@Pc@VW^MhAc@`B{@lAw@zCyA`@KvEyB`Ao@PQNK';
var paths = google.maps.geometry.encoding.decodePath(code);
var flightPath = new google.maps.Polyline({
path:pathss,